How To Choose The Best Multivitamin For Building Muscle Mass
A multivitamin optimized for muscle growth needs to do more than cover the RDA. You need forms that actually absorb, doses that support protein metabolism, and ingredients that directly fuel the anabolic environment. Here’s what separates a mass-building multi from a generic capsule.
Methylated B-Vitamins vs. Standard Forms
Standard folic acid and cyanocobalamin require liver conversion that many men handle poorly. Methylated forms—methylfolate and methylcobalamin—bypass that bottleneck and directly fuel the methylation cycle, which governs protein synthesis, red blood cell production, and energy metabolism. For muscle builders, this means more usable fuel for every set and faster repair.
Mineral Forms That Actually Absorb
Zinc oxide and magnesium oxide are cheap fillers with poor bioavailability. Look for zinc bisglycinate, magnesium citrate or glycinate, and copper bisglycinate. These chelated forms survive stomach acid and deliver the mineral where it matters—supporting testosterone production, muscle contraction, and connective tissue repair.
Vitamin D3 and K2 for Muscle Function
Vitamin D3 directly influences muscle protein synthesis and strength adaptation. Without adequate K2, calcium can accumulate in soft tissue instead of bone, impairing recovery. A mass-building multi should pair D3 with K2 (menaquinone-7) to keep calcium metabolism balanced and support joint health under heavy loads.
CoQ10 and Adaptogens for Recovery
Coenzyme Q10 supports mitochondrial energy output, which matters for both workout performance and overnight repair. Adaptogens like ashwagandha and panax ginseng help manage cortisol—keeping catabolic stress low so your body stays in an anabolic state longer.
